Position Overview

As a Project Engineer, you will be responsible for the administrative and technical aspects of constructing a project, managing a team of field and cost engineers.

In this role, you will be the main conduit of information between the Project or Construction Manager and the team for cost, revenue, cash flow information;

and therefore requires strong interpersonal and time management skills. Project Engineers may work as the Project Manager on some of our smaller projects and will be expected to develop the team below them.

District Overview

Kiewit Building Group specializes in constructing office buildings, industrial complexes, education and sports facilities, hotels, hospitals, transportation terminals, science and technology facilities, manufacturing, retail and special-use facilities and extensive interior construction with tenant improvements.

Its capabilities include general construction, construction management, design-build, design-assist and turn-key project development.

Kiewit also provides fast, accurate preconstruction project management services. During the past 10 years, Kiewit has performed construction services for more than 1,100 vertical construction projects, totaling $7.5 billion in revenue.
